Over time, the lubricant on the metal rod holding the scanner carriage dries out. Open the scanner housing, clean the old grease with rubbing alcohol, and apply a thin layer of silicone grease.
The scanner error on the Samsung SCX-4300 typically manifests in one of two ways: either the LCD displays “Scanner Error” directly, or the scanner carriage makes a loud banging or clicking sound as it repeatedly slams against the side during startup before the error appears. In either case, scanning and copying become unavailable, while printing often continues to work normally.
